1LQU
Mycobacterium tuberculosis FprA in complex with NADPH
Experimental procedure
| Experimental method | SINGLE WAVELENGTH |
| Source type | SYNCHROTRON |
| Source details | EMBL/DESY, HAMBURG BEAMLINE X11 |
| Synchrotron site | EMBL/DESY, HAMBURG |
| Beamline | X11 |
| Temperature [K] | 100 |
| Detector technology | IMAGE PLATE |
| Collection date | 2001-07-31 |
| Detector | MARRESEARCH |
| Wavelength(s) | 1.0 |
| Spacegroup name | P 21 21 21 |
| Unit cell lengths | 69.507, 89.466, 161.658 |
| Unit cell angles | 90.00, 90.00, 90.00 |
Refinement procedure
| Resolution | 40.000 - 1.250 |
| R-factor | 0.12565 |
| Rwork | 0.126 |
| R-free | 0.14200 |
| Structure solution method | FOURIER SYNTHESIS |
| Starting model (for MR) | 1qlt |
| RMSD bond length | 0.014 |
| RMSD bond angle | 1.666 * |
| Data reduction software | MOSFLM |
| Data scaling software | SCALA |
| Refinement software | REFMAC (5.0) |

Crystallization Conditions
| crystal ID | method | pH | temperature | details |
| 1 | VAPOR DIFFUSION, HANGING DROP | 7 * | 4 * | PEG4000, pH 5.6, VAPOR DIFFUSION, HANGING DROP, temperature 277K |
Crystallization Reagents in Literatures
| ID | crystal ID | solution | reagent name | concentration (unit) | details |
| 1 | 1 | drop | protein | 25 (mg/ml) | |
| 2 | 1 | drop | HEPES-KOH | 10 (mM) | pH7.0 |
| 3 | 1 | drop | glycerol | 10 (%(v/v)) | |
| 4 | 1 | drop | dithiothreitol | 5 (mM) | |
| 5 | 1 | drop | NADP+ | 0.65 (mM) | |
| 6 | 1 | reservoir | PEG4000 | 30 (%(w/v)) | |
| 7 | 1 | reservoir | sodium citrate | 0.1 (M) | pH5.6 |
| 8 | 1 | reservoir | ammonium acetate | 0.2 (M) |
